Constitutionalization of European Private Law
Explore the intricate relationship between fundamental rights and contractual obligations in Hans-W Micklitz's insightful work, Constitutionalization of European Private Law. Published by Oxford University Press in 2014, this hardback edition spans 288 pages, delving into the significant influence of the Charter of Fundamental Rights on European Union law. Micklitz meticulously investigates how these rights shape the legal landscape for EU citizens, particularly within the realm of private law.
